Mineral Exploration: The Exploration Drilling Phase

The exploration drilling phase is the final and most intensive stage of mineral exploration. It focuses on confirming the mineral deposit's size, grade, and structure, and providing data essential for mine planning and development.

Core Objectives of Exploration Drilling

  1. Resource Definition: Precisely measure the dimensions, grade, and tonnage of the mineral deposit.

  2. Geotechnical Analysis: Provide data on rock stability and other factors crucial for mining operations.

  3. Metallurgical Testing: Assess ore processing and recovery methods.

Essential Equipment and Techniques

  • Exploration coring drill rig: Vital for deep drilling and resource estimation.

  • Portable full-hydraulic core drilling rig: Provides mobility and efficiency in diverse conditions.

  • Wireline exploration machine: Enables quick and effective core recovery, minimizing operational delays.

  • Diamond core drilling tools: Ensure high-precision samples required for accurate resource modeling.

Real-World Example: Copper Project in Australia

In an Australian copper project, exploration drilling was executed using wireline machines and portable full-hydraulic rigs. These tools ensured maximum core recovery, even in fractured formations. Diamond core drilling tools provided high-fidelity samples, facilitating accurate deposit modeling.
